What are equilibrium solutions?

⇒ It is the response to which other responses either move in the opposite direction or tend to approach when t. Because the solution does not depend on time (or any other variable you are integrating over) at those moments, the situation is in equilibrium. Stable solutions are those that "attract" other solutions that started nearby. Stable solutions are those that don't "push away" unstable ones that started nearby. Finally, solutions that, depending on the side from which other solutions started, either attract or push other solutions are referred to as semi-stable solutions. The values of y for which the differential equation states that dy/dt=0 are the equilibrium solutions. Therefore, at those values of y, there are constant solutions.
